A Comparative Study of Diesel Oil and Soybean Oil as Oil-Based Drilling Mud Oil-based mud (OBM) was formulated with soybean oil extracted from soybean using the Soxhlet extraction method. The formulated soybean mud properties were compared with diesel oil mud properties.

A Comparative Study of Diesel Oil and Soybean Oil as Oil-Based Drilling Mud. The compared properties were rheological properties, yield point and gel strength, and mud density and filtration loss properties, fluid loss and filter cake.The results obtained show that the soybean oil mud exhibited Bingham plastic rheological model with applicable (low)...

This article examines the CO2 emissions from the combustion of a biodiesel-diesel blend in stationary internal combustion engines to generate electricity. Emissions were analyzed according to the feedstock used for biodiesel production – soybean oil, palm oil, waste frying oil – through the methyl and ethyl routes.
